Nuclear Reactors: Thorium

Asked by Peter LambLabourDepartment for Energy Security and Net ZeroTabled Answered 22 May 2025UIN 52539

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Energy Security and Net Zero, whether he has made an assessment of the potential merits of developing thorium-based molten salt reactors in the UK.

Answered by Michael Shanks

Nuclear is a key part of the government's national mission to be a clean energy superpower. The government believes that Advanced Nuclear Technologies (ANTs) could play an important role in helping the UK achieve energy security and clean power while securing thousands of good, skilled jobs.

DESNZ is aware of and monitors the progress of a wide range of advanced reactors in design development by companies around the world, including Thorium Molten Salt reactors.
